Very adjustable
I like the adjustability of this product. The mousepad rotates 360. The armrest adjusts in height and tilt degree and also rotates 360. The only con is the large black knob that adjusts the clamping of the whole thing onto your desk. It's too bulky, which caused the contraption to not fit where I actually wanted it (as close as possible to my pullout keyboard). It's still okay because of the adjustability, but my arm is off to the side farther than I would want it to be. A different desk may not have the same problem and may have plenty of room for the knob.

Drawbacks
I used the arm rest for a week but ended up returning it. Three drawbacks led to my decision:1) The mouse pad is elevated above desk level so your arm will be higher than with your previous situation. In my case, that led to shoulder pain because putting my full arm weight on the arm rest would likely have broken the clamp that attached it to my desk.2) The height of the arm rest is adjustable so it can be below, level with, or above the mouse pad. That's a good thing. But the design is such that in each instance the arm rest and mouse pad are parallel with the floor. While that might seem like a good thing, it can lead to discomfort.3) The mouse pad surface hearkens back to to early mouse pads geared to work with roller ball mice. But my Microsoft optical mouse constantly had troubles caused by the occasional stray dust particle or cat hair that landed and adhered to the porous surface. Once every few minutes I had to blow or pick stuff off the pad so my mouse would work.

Immediately reduced my "mouse elbow" pain
I purchased this as I had a recurrence (worse) of mouse elbow that had been helped by using a vertical mouse. However, I really pushed myself too far by returning to using my right hand at work for mousing, and increasing my video gaming time (world of warcraft). I paid the price. Excruciating pain and inability to grasp or lift. I determined that the biggest cause of pain was the "hanging" of my elbow, but did not know that these products existed. I googled "mouse arm rest" and found it, and after looking at multiple models and reviews, ordered this. It arrived on time, and was very easy to set up. I tried resting my elbow on it which didnt work, but now have a nice position where my forearm rests on it. Within several days, and being a video game enthusiast, I played WoW at my same rate, even longer, and found that my pain lessened, and my grasping was not as painful. Now, about five days after using this (and switching back to my left hand for work) the pain is virtually gone except for the slightest tinge. Nowhere near what it was beforeBottom line: This thing works. It takes the stress off of the elbow muscles and tendons completely.Adjustment: very easy to tweak as it "ratchets" a few milimeters in two different locations.Size: it really is smaller than I thought, which is good. I attached it to my slide-out keyboard tray.Position: I recommend you adjust it so your mid-rear forearm rests on the moveable arm.Movement: fluid and so good you barely notice its there.Comfort: I find the mouse pad to be a bit hard, but the arm pad is great.
